It's not just vitamin levels. Breast milk is a dynamic, responsive fluid that changes by the hour depending on what the baby's body needs.
If the baby is thirsty, the milk comes out with a higher water content. This is the thinner "foremilk" that flows at the start of a feed. If the baby is hungry and needs energy, the milk becomes progressively fattier. This richer "hindmilk" comes later in the feed and carries more calories.
The immune response is probably the most remarkable part. When a baby has a cold, respiratory infection, or any pathogen exposure, traces of that pathogen appear in the saliva. The breast detects this and increases the production of secretory immunoglobulin A (SIgA), the primary antibody in breast milk. The next feed arrives loaded with targeted antibodies specifically built for what the baby is currently fighting. This is why milk sometimes appears more yellow or golden during illness.
The sleep cycle effect is also well documented. Breast milk contains different concentrations of nucleotides and melatonin depending on the time of day. Milk expressed at night carries higher melatonin levels, which encourages sleep. Daytime milk carries more cortisol and activating nucleotides that support alertness. Some researchers now advise against mixing day and night expressed milk in the same bottle for this reason, because you are essentially scrambling a biological clock signal meant for the baby.
